What the story of The Kerala Story?

When it comes to the plot of the movie The Kerala Story, it depicts the real-life events of those Hindu and Christian females who were forced to engage in acts of love jihad by Islamists and ultimately sent to Afghanistan, Iraq, and Syria to join ISIS as terrorists. On May 5, The Kerala Story will be available in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, and Malayalam. The protagonist of the trailer is a young woman named Shalini Unnikrishnan, who is portrayed by Adah Sharma. Adah's acquaintance was revealed in the teaser to be an ISIS recruiter who coerces girls into becoming Muslims. In addition, she arranges marriages between girls and Muslim young men. The victimised girls are then accepted into ISIS after this.

The struggle of Hindu and Christian women in the nation, who were first brainwashed and coerced to convert to Islam before becoming ISIS terrorists, is depicted in the movie. Produced by Vipul Amrutlal Shah, this movie is directed by Sudipto Sen. Adah Sharma, Yogita Bihani, Sonia Balani, and Siddhi Idnani, on the other hand, had significant roles in the movie.
